New Law in Action Now - No talking or texting on phone in school zones

Aug 06, 2018 at 02:04 pm by bryan


With schools now open again, motorists in school zones should be aware that talking on a cell phone with the device in hand is now illegal in an active school zone.

That not only includes talking on a phone, but texting or reading texts as well.

The law states that it's an offense - Class C misdemeanor, punishable by a fine of up to $50 - for a person to knowingly operate a motor vehicle in any marked school zone in this state, when a warning flasher or flashers are in operation, and talking on a hand-held mobile telephone while the vehicle is in motion.

However, the offense is not committed if the telephone is equipped with a hands-free device, for drivers 18 years of age and older.

A driver under age 18 is breaking the law talking either using a hands-free or handheld phone while driving through an active school zone.
